Landscape curbing replacement involves removing old, damaged, or worn-out concrete or stone borders that define garden beds, walkways, and lawn areas. Over time, these borders can crack, shift, or become uneven due to weather, soil movement, or general wear and tear. Professional service providers can carefully dismantle the existing curbing and replace it with fresh, durable materials that enhance the appearance and functionality of outdoor spaces. This process helps restore a property's curb appeal while ensuring the boundaries remain secure and visually appealing.

Many common problems lead homeowners to seek landscape curbing replacement. Cracked or crumbling borders can pose safety hazards or allow grass and weeds to invade flower beds and walkways. Shifting or uneven borders may disrupt the clean lines of a landscape design, making a yard look neglected. Additionally, older curbing materials can fade or deteriorate, diminishing the overall aesthetic of a property. Replacing damaged or outdated borders provides a fresh, polished look and helps maintain the integrity of landscape features.

This service is often used on residential properties, including single-family homes, townhouses, and multi-unit complexes. Homeowners who want to improve curb appeal or address specific landscape issues frequently turn to local contractors for curbing replacement. Properties with extensive gardens, decorative borders, or defined lawn areas benefit from updated borders that help keep mulch, gravel, or soil contained. Commercial properties, community parks, and public spaces may also require curbing replacement to maintain a tidy, professional appearance.

The overview below groups typical Landscape Curbing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Asheville,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or landscape curbing repairs or replacements range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for simple fixes or small sections. Larger, more complex projects tend to cost more and are less common in this tier.

Basic Replacement - Replacing existing landscape curbing with standard materials usually costs between $1,000 and $2,500. Most local contractors handle projects within this range, which covers common residential yard upgrades. Larger or detailed designs can push costs higher but are less frequent.

Mid-Range Projects - Mid-sized landscape curbing installations or replacements typically range from $2,500 to $5,000. Many homeowners opt for these projects when upgrading multiple sections or adding decorative features. Projects exceeding this range are less common but available for more extensive work.

Full-Scale Installations - Large or complex landscape curbing projects, such as extensive property overhauls or custom designs, can reach $5,000 or more. These projects are less frequent and usually involve detailed planning and high-end materials handled by experienced local pros.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is landscape curbing replacement? Landscape curbing replacement involves removing existing concrete or stone borders and installing new edging to enhance the appearance and functionality of landscape areas.

When should landscape curbing be replaced? Replacement is typically considered when existing curbing is cracked, damaged, or no longer complements the landscape design.

What materials are used for landscape curbing replacement? Common materials include concrete, stone, brick, or other durable substances selected to match the landscape style and withstand local weather conditions.

How can local contractors assist with curbing replacement? Local service providers can evaluate existing curbing, recommend suitable materials, and handle the installation process to ensure a professional result.

What are the benefits of replacing landscape curbing? Replacing old or damaged curbing can improve curb appeal, define landscape features better, and increase property value in Asheville and nearby areas.
